Overheard a guy at a dispensary say he only vapes at 350F for flavor

I usually crank mine up to 400F and I'm wondering if I'm missing out on better taste or just being too impatient for clouds, has anyone tested this side by side?

Yeah try it out for a day or two, it's a completely different experience honestly. I was a cloud chaser for the longest time too and always ran hot, but once I actually sat down and did a side by side with my favorite strain, the flavor difference was massive. You lose some of the subtle notes above 380 or so, and those are the ones that really make the strain pop. I still go higher sometimes when I just want a quick hit, but 350-360 has become my sweet spot for savoring it.
